we've got an institution which used Deployment via Baramundi before.

They've got the option for "install Apllications on Shutdown" to prevent that the (3rdParty) Software they want to Update is not in Use.

Is there a similar option in MECM/SCCM or combined with a script?

    I'm afraid MECM do not has the option to "install applications on shutdown", but SCCM can use maintenance windows to define when Configuration Manager can run impacting tasks on devices.
